The Greek artistic community is mourning the loss of Maro Kontou, a celebrated actress who died on Wednesday, July 15, at the age of 92. Her funeral is scheduled for Friday, July 17, at the First Cemetery of Athens, where family, friends, and colleagues will gather to bid farewell.
Kontou had reportedly shared a poignant final wish with a close friend, Nikitas Kaklamanis. She asked that during future gatherings of their circle, a cigarette and a glass of whiskey be placed on her empty chair, a testament to her enduring spirit and desire to remain a part of their fellowship.
Leave a cigarette and a whiskey on my chair.
Despite having recently been discharged from the hospital, the veteran actress had been facing serious health issues. A medical announcement from "Agios Savvas" Hospital confirmed her passing due to a severe deterioration of her condition, despite the dedicated efforts of the medical staff to save her life. The announcement expressed sincere condolences to her loved ones.
